“Implied” Agreement on US Defense Equipment of EUR 500 billion from EU member states has been allegedly existing between USA – Commission On the sidelines of the Trump – von der Liean meeting in Scotland on July 27, 2025, according to newsit.gr information by analysts with good knowledge of the consultations between the two sides of the Atlantic.
It is recalled that until yesterday there was officially dominating a hallmark between the US – Commission regarding whether there was an agreement with each other on the purchase of US defense systems by Europeans.
On the one hand, in a statement, the White House on July 28, 2025, explicitly states that “the European Union has agreed to buy significant quantities of US military equipment”.
On the other hand, in the newsletter issued by the Commission on July 29, 2025, he makes no mention of any such “agreement”, while sources from Brussels are talking about “expectations” Trump (and in no way “agreement”).
However, Newsit.gr sources report that the corridors of the Commission circulate a number, and this is 500 billion euros (ie 62% of the total Rearm EU/ SAFE package) and concerns the purchase of US equipment in the next 3.5 years, ie in the midst of the mid -term year.
The € 500 billion, according to the same sources, will not be paid during that time, but they will relate to orders, the full execution of which will take more than 2029.
In addition, the new NATO goal, namely 5% of GDP on behalf of defense spending, has a horizon in 2035, the same sources said.
With these “data”, the total volume of markets that the EU pledged to proceed by the Americans is 1.2 trillion. Euro: 700 billion euros is for the US energy market (which is provided in official US and EU announcements) and an additional € 500 billion for the purchase of US weapons (which is not provided in any official announcement so far).
Thus, if these markets estimates are verified, taking into account the announcements of additional European investment in the US of € 600 billion, as well as the expected revenue of 15% in European imports, the total package of the agreement (publicized and “silent”) in the astronomical amount of 1.9. euro.
